/*
|
||||
* The THC63LVD1024 clock frequency range is 8 to 135 MHz in single-in
|
||||
* mode. Note that the limits are different in dual-in, single-out mode,
|
||||
* and will need to be adjusted accordingly.
|
||||
* The THC63LVD1024 pixel rate range is 8 to 135 MHz in all modes but
|
||||
* dual-in, single-out where it is 40 to 150 MHz. As dual-in, dual-out
|
||||
* isn't supported by the driver yet, simply derive the limits from the
|
||||
* input mode.
|
||||
*/
